Exit window installation services involve the process of fitting specialized windows into designated openings within a building’s exterior. These windows are typically designed to serve as emergency exits, egress points, or access points for maintenance and safety purposes. The installation process includes measuring the opening,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ring the window is properly fitted and sealed to meet safety and building standards. Skilled contractors focus on precise fitting to prevent leaks, drafts, and security issues, ensuring the window functions correctly as an emergency exit or access point.
This service addresses common problems such as inadequate egress pathways, outdated or damaged windows, and safety compliance issues. Properties with aging windows that no longer meet safety codes may require egress windows to ensure safe escape routes in emergencies. Additionally, properties experiencing drafts, leaks, or security concerns can benefit from professional installation, which enhances both safety and energy efficiency. Properly installed exit windows also contribute to improved property value and compliance with local building regulations.

Cost of Exit Window Installation - The typical cost range for installing an exit window varies from approximately $1,200 to $3,500 dep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or custom-sized windows tend to incre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Labor and Material Costs - Labor costs for exit window installation generally range between $500 and $1,500, while materials may add an additional $700 to $2,000. The total price depends on factors like window type, framing requirements, and existing structure conditions. Contact local contractors for precise quotes.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as permits, structural modifications, or finishing work can range from $200 to $800. These expenses depend on the project's scope and local building codes. Professionals can help identify potential additional charges during consultation.
Average Project Cost - Overall, the average cost for exit window installation in the Cabarrus County area typically falls between $2,000 and $4,500. Prices may vary based on window size, location, and specific project details. Local service providers can offer personalized c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an exit window? An exit window is a specially designed window that provides a safe egress point from a building, typically used in bedrooms and basements.
Why is proper installation important? Correct installation ensures the window meets safety standards and functions properly for emergency escape and rescue.
How long does an exit window installation typically take? Installation times can vary based on the property and window type, but generally, it can be completed within a day by local service providers.
Are there specific building codes for exit windows? Yes, local building codes specify size, egress requirements, and other safety standards for exit windows.
